The percentage errors in the measurement of mass, length, and time are 1 % , 2 % , and 3 % respectively. Match List-I (Physical Quantity) with List-II (Maximum Percentage Error) based on these measurements. List-I List-II (A) Velocity (I) 9 % (B) Acceleration (II) 11 % (C) Force (III) 5 % (D) Kinetic Energy (IV) 8 % Choose the correct answer from the options given below:

Options

  1. A(A)-(III), (B)-(IV), (C)-(I), (D)-(II)
  2. B(A)-(III), (B)-(IV), (C)-(II), (D)-(I)
  3. C(A)-(IV), (B)-(III), (C)-(I), (D)-(II)
  4. D(A)-(I), (B)-(II), (C)-(III), (D)-(IV)

Correct answer

A. (A)-(III), (B)-(IV), (C)-(I), (D)-(II)

Step-by-step solution

The maximum percentage error is calculated using the dimensional formula of each quantity, where errors are always added regardless of whether the power is positive or negative. For Velocity [LT⁻¹] : Maximum percentage error = %L + %T = 2 % + 3 % = 5 % . This matches (A) with (III). For Acceleration [LT⁻²] : Maximum percentage error = %L + 2( %T) = 2 % + 2(3 %) = 8 % . This matches (B) with (IV). For Force [MLT⁻²] : Maximum percentage error = %M + %L + 2( %T) = 1 % + 2 % + 2(3 %) = 9 % . This matches (C) with (I).
